Output 31070306e6a1158c6944b170aa68c87ee2be315d35359cab3f2ec2bfbd2f10a8:7

value
39820
script pubkey
OP_0 OP_PUSHBYTES_32 8d0f23894b74a952d9386e5c381b5ff21cb8cc871a2f42a1881512ff8b3a976f
address
tb1q358j8z2twj549kfcdewrsx6l7gwt3ny8rgh59gvgz5f0lze6jahs8l9pn3
transaction
31070306e6a1158c6944b170aa68c87ee2be315d35359cab3f2ec2bfbd2f10a8
confirmations
61893
spent
true